Neuropsychopharmacology | 1996

Olanzapine versus placebo and haloperidol: acute phase results of the North American double-blind olanzapine trial.

Charles M. Beasley; Gary D. Tollefson; Pierre Tran; Winston Satterlee; T.M. Sanger; S.H. Hamilton

Olanzapine is a potential new “atypical” antipsychotic agent. The double-blind acute phase of this study compared three dosage ranges of olanzapine (5 ± 2.5 mg/day [Olz-L], 10 ± 2.5 mg/day [Olz-M], 15 ± 2.5 mg/day [Olz-H]) to a dosage range of haloperidol (15 ± 5 mg/day [Hal]) and to placebo in the treatment of 335 patients who met the DSM-III-R criteria for schizophrenia. In overall symptomatology improvement (Brief Psychiatric Rating Scale [BPRS]-total), Olz-M, Olz-H, and Hal were significantly superior to placebo. In positive symptom improvement (BPRS-positive), Olz-M, Olz-H, and Hal were comparable and significantly superior to placebo. In negative symptom improvement (Scale for the Assessment of Negative Symptoms [SANS]-composite), Olz-L and Olz-H were significantly superior to placebo and Olz-H was also significantly superior to Hal. The most common treatment-emergent adverse events included somnolence, agitation, asthenia, and nervousness. No acute dystonia was observed with olanzapine. Treatment-emergent parkinsonism occurred with Olz-H at approximately one-third the rate of Hal, and akathisia occurred with Olz-H at approximately one-half the rate of Hal. Prolactin elevations associated with olanzapine were not significantly greater than those observed with placebo and were also significantly less than those seen with haloperidol.


Psychopharmacology | 1996

Olanzapine versus placebo : results of a double-blind, fixed-dose olanzapine trial

Charles M. Beasley; T.M. Sanger; Winston Satterlee; Gary D. Tollefson; Pierre V. Tran; S.H. Hamilton

Olanzapine is a potential new “atypical” antipsychotic agent. This double-blind, acute phase study compared two doses of olanzapine [1 mg/day (Olz1.0); 10 mg/day (Olz10.0)] with placebo in the treatment of 152 patients who met the DSM-III-R criteria for schizophrenia and had a Brief Psychiatric Rating Scale (BPRS)-total score (items scored 0–6) ≥24. In overall symptomatology improvement [BPRS-total score and Positive and Negative Syndrome Scale (PANSS)-total score], Olz10.0 was statistically significantly superior to placebo. In positive symptom improvement (PANSS-positive score, BPRS-positive score), Olz10.0 was statistically significantly superior to placebo. In negative symptom improvement (PANSS-negative score), Olz10.0 was statistically superior to placebo. Olz 1.0 was clinically comparable to placebo in all efficacy comparisons. The only adverse event to show an overall statistically significant incidence difference was anorexia (reported for 10% of placebo-treated and 0% of Olz10.0-treated patients). The Olz10.0-treated patients improved over baseline with respect to parkinsonian and akathisia symptoms, and these changes were comparable with those observed with placebo. There were no dystonias associated with Olz10.0 treatment. At endpoint, the incidence of patients with elevated prolactin values did not differ statistically significantly between placebo-treated and Olz10.0-treated patients. Olanzapine appears to be not only safe and effective, but a promising atypical antipsychotic candidate.


BMJ | 1991

Fluoxetine and suicide: a meta-analysis of controlled trials of treatment for depression.

Charles M. Beasley; Bruce E. Dornseif; Janet C. Bosomworth; Mary E. Sayler; Alvin H. Rampey; John H. Heiligenstein; Vicki L. Thompson; Dennis J. Murphy; Daniel N. Masica

OBJECTIVE--A comprehensive meta-analysis of clinical trial data was performed to assess the possible association of fluoxetine and suicidality (suicidal acts and ideation). DESIGN--Retrospective analysis of pooled data from 17 double blind clinical trials in patients with major depressive disorder comparing fluoxetine (n = 1765) with a tricyclic antidepressant (n = 731) or placebo (n = 569), or both. MAIN OUTCOME MEASURES--Multiple data sources were searched to identify patients with suicidal acts. Suicidal ideation was assessed with item 3 of the Hamilton depression rating scale, which systematically rates suicidality. Emergence of substantial suicidal ideation was defined as a change in the rating of this item from 0 or 1 at baseline to 3 or 4 during double blind treatment; worsening was defined as any increase from baseline; improvement was defined as a decrease from baseline at the last visit during the treatment. RESULTS--Suicidal acts did not differ significantly in comparisons of fluoxetine with placebo (0.2% v 0.2%, p = 0.494, Mantel-Haenszel adjusted incidence difference) and with tricyclic antidepressants (0.7% v 0.4%, p = 0.419). The pooled incidence of suicidal acts was 0.3% for fluoxetine, 0.2% for placebo, and 0.4% for tricyclic antidepressants, and fluoxetine did not differ significantly from either placebo (p = 0.533, Pearsons chi 2) or tricyclic antidepressants (p = 0.789). Suicidal ideation emerged marginally significantly less often with fluoxetine than with placebo (0.9% v 2.6%, p = 0.094) and numerically less often than with tricyclic antidepressants (1.7% v 3.6%, p = 0.102). The pooled incidence of emergence of substantial suicidal ideation was 1.2% for fluoxetine, 2.6% for placebo, and 3.6% for tricyclic antidepressants. The incidence was significantly lower with fluoxetine than with placebo (p = 0.042) and tricyclic antidepressants (p = 0.001). Any degree of worsening of suicidal ideation was similar with fluoxetine and placebo (15.4% v 17.9%, p = 0.196) and with fluoxetine and tricyclic antidepressants (15.6% v 16.3%, p = 0.793). The pooled incidence of worsening of suicidal ideation was 15.3% for fluoxetine, 17.9% for placebo, and 16.3% for tricyclic antidepressants. The incidence did not differ significantly with fluoxetine and placebo (p = 0.141) or tricyclic antidepressants (p = 0.542). Suicidal ideation improved significantly more with fluoxetine than with placebo (72.0% v 54.8%, p less than 0.001) and was similar to the improvement with tricyclic antidepressants (72.5% v 69.8%, p = 0.294). The pooled incidence of improvement of suicidal ideation was 72.2% for fluoxetine, 54.8% for placebo, and 69.8% for tricyclic antidepressants. The incidence with fluoxetine was significantly greater than with placebo (p less than 0.001) and did not differ from that with tricyclic antidepressants (p = 0.296). CONCLUSIONS--Data from these trials do not show that fluoxetine is associated with an increased risk of suicidal acts or emergence of substantial suicidal thoughts among depressed patients.


European Neuropsychopharmacology | 1997

OLANZAPINE VERSUS HALOPERIDOL : ACUTE PHASE RESULTS OF THE INTERNATIONAL DOUBLE-BLIND OLANZAPINE TRIAL

Charles M. Beasley; S.H. Hamilton; Ann Marie K. Crawford; Mary Anne Dellva; Gary D. Tollefson; Pierre V. Tran; Olivier Blin; Jean-Noel Beuzen

A 6-week acute phase of an international 1-year double-blind study was conducted comparing three dose ranges of olanzapine (5 +/- 2.5 mg/day, 10 +/- 2.5 mg/day, and 15 +/- 2.5 mg/day) with a fixed dose of olanzapine (1.0 mg/day) and with a dose range of haloperidol (15 +/- 5 mg/day) in the treatment of 431 patients with schizophrenia. The purpose was to determine whether olanzapine demonstrated a dose-related ability to decrease overall psychopathology with minimal associated extrapyramidal symptoms in patients with schizophrenia. The high-dose olanzapine group showed statistically significantly greater improvement in overall psychopathology based on mean change in the CGI Severity score and statistically significantly greater improvement in positive psychotic symptoms based on mean change in both the BPRS positive score and the PANSS positive score compared with the 1.0-mg/day olanzapine group. Analyses indicated that an increasing dose-response curve was observed across the range of all olanzapine dose groups. Acute extrapyramidal syndromes were reported less frequently among all olanzapine groups compared with the haloperidol group. Endpoint mean change on both the Simpson-Angus Scale and the Barnes Akathisia Scale reflected improvement for all olanzapine treatment groups compared with worsening for the haloperidol group. Olanzapine was associated with weight gain but did not appear to have any clinically meaningful effect on vital signs. Although olanzapine was associated with some increase in prolactin concentrations, increases were transient, occurred less often, and were of lesser magnitude than those observed with haloperidol.


Neuropsychopharmacology | 2002

Comparison of rapidly acting intramuscular olanzapine, lorazepam, and placebo: a double-blind, randomized study in acutely agitated patients with dementia.

Karena Meehan; Huei Wang; S.R. David; Jennifer R. Nisivoccia; Barry Jones; Charles M. Beasley; Peter D. Feldman; Jacobo Mintzer; Louise M. Beckett; Alan Breier

This double-blind study investigated the efficacy and safety of rapid-acting intramuscular olanzapine in treating agitation associated with Alzheimers disease and/or vascular dementia. At 2 h, olanzapine (5.0 mg, 2.5 mg) and lorazepam (1.0 mg) showed significant improvement over placebo on the PANSS Excited Component (PANSS-EC) and Agitation–Calmness Evaluation Scale (ACES), and both 5.0 mg olanzapine and lorazepam showed superiority to placebo on the Cohen-Mansfield Agitation Inventory. At 24 h, both olanzapine groups maintained superiority over placebo on the PANSS-EC; lorazepam did not. Olanzapine (5.0 mg) and lorazepam improved ACES scores more than placebo. Simpson–Angus and Mini-Mental State Examination scores did not change significantly from baseline. Sedation (ACES ⩾8), adverse events, and laboratory analytes were not significantly different from placebo for any treatment. No significant differences among treatment groups were seen in extrapyramidal symptoms or in corrected QT interval at either 2 h or 24 h, and no significant differences among treatment groups were seen in vital signs, including orthostasis. Intramuscular injection of olanzapine may therefore provide substantial benefit in rapidly treating inpatients with acute dementia-related agitation.


Quality of Life Research | 1999

Olanzapine versus haloperidol in the treatment of schizophrenia and other psychotic disorders: Quality of life and clinical outcomes of a randomized clinical trial

Dennis A. Revicki; Laura A. Genduso; S.H. Hamilton; Dara Ganoczy; Charles M. Beasley

Background: Little information is available on the impact of the atypical antipsychotic olanzapine on quality of life (QOL). A 6-week, double-blind randomized multicenter trial, with a long-term extension, was conducted to evaluate the clinical efficacy and QOL of olanzapine and haloperidol in treating schizophrenia and other psychotic disorders. Methods: A total of 828 outpatients provided QOL data. Study patients were aged greater than 18 years with a DSM-III-R diagnosis of schizophrenia, schizophreniform disorder, or schizoaffective disorder and baseline BPRS (items scored on 0–6 scale) total scores, ≥18 were randomized to 6 weeks of treatment with olanzapine 5 to 20 mg/day or haloperidol 5 to 20 mg/day. Patients entered a 46-week double-blind extension if they demonstrated minimal clinical response and were tolerant to study medication. The Quality of Life Scale (QLS) and SF-36 Health Survey were used to evaluate QOL. Results: During the 6-week acute phase, olanzapine treatment significantly improved BPRS total (p = 0.004), PANSS total scores (p = 0.043), QLS total (p = 0.005), intrapsychic foundations (p < 0.001) and interpersonal relations scores (p = 0.036), and SF-36 mental component summary scores (p < 0.001) compared with haloperidol. During the extension phase, olanzapine treatment significantly improved PANSS negative scores (p = 0.035) and improved QLS total (p = 0.001), intrapsychic foundations (p < 0.001), and instrumental role category scores (p = 0.015) versus haloperidol treatment. Significantly more haloperidol patients discontinued treatment due to adverse events during the acute and extension phases (p = 0.041 and p = 0.014, respectively). Changes in QLS total and MCS scores were associated with changes in clinical symptoms, depression scores and extrapyramidal symptoms. Conclusions: Olanzapine was more effective than haloperidol in reducing severity of psychopathology and in improving QOL in patients with schizophrenia and other psychotic disorders. The QOL benefits of olanzapine, although modest, may be important for long-term treatment.


Journal of Clinical Psychopharmacology | 2001

Olanzapine plasma concentrations and clinical response : Acute phase results of the North American Olanzapine Trial

Paul J. Perry; Brian C. Lund; T.M. Sanger; Charles M. Beasley

Olanzapine is an atypical antipsychotic that is effective in the treatment of schizophrenia. Olanzapine plasma concentrations ≥ 9.3 ng/mL (24 hours postdose) have been identified as a predictor of clinical response in acutely ill patients with schizophrenia. The authors report a receiver operating characteristic (ROC) curve analysis of 12-hour olanzapine concentrations and treatment response from the North American Double-Blind Olanzapine Trial. After a 4- to 7-day placebo lead-in, patients meeting DSM-III-R criteria for schizophrenia were randomly assigned to receive olanzapine, haloperidol, or placebo. Patients who were randomly assigned to receive olanzapine were given daily doses ranging from 2.5 to 17.5 mg/day for up to 6 weeks. Blood samples for the determination of olanzapine plasma concentrations were obtained between 10 and 16 hours (11.7 ± 1.7 hours) after the last dose was administered. Therapeutic response data and olanzapine concentrations used for analysis were obtained from the endpoint visit for each patient if the patient had been receiving a fixed olanzapine dose for at least the last 2 weeks of the study. Plasma concentrations from previous visits were used if endpoint concentrations were invalid. Response was defined as a ≥ 20% reduction in Brief Psychiatric Rating Scale (BPRS) scores and a Clinical Global Impression (CGI) Severity scale score of ≤ 3 or a final BPRS score of ≤ 35. The final ROC analysis included data from 84 patients and suggested an olanzapine concentration ≥ 2 3.2 ng/mL to be a predictor of therapeutic response. Fifty-two percent of patients with 12-hour olanzapine concentrations ≥ 23.2 ng/mL responded, whereas only 25% of patients with concentrations <23.2 ng/mL responded. Furthermore, an olanzapine concentration ≥ 23.2 ng/mL was a predictor of response in the Scale for the Assessment of Negative Symptoms (≥ 20% decrease and endpoint CGI ≤ 3). Olanzapine concentrations were found to be a function of olanzapine dose (in milligrams per day) and gender such that prospective olanzapine dosing is feasible. A 12-hour olanzapine plasma concentration of >23.2 ng/mL was a predictor of therapeutic response in acutely ill patients with schizophrenia. Males required a higher olanzapine dose to reach this threshold concentration than their female counterparts.


Journal of Affective Disorders | 1999

Fluoxetine efficacy in menopausal women with and without estrogen replacement

Jay D. Amsterdam; Felipe Garcia-Espana; Jan Fawcett; Frederic M. Quitkin; Fredrick W. Reimherr; Jerrold F. Rosenbaum; Charles M. Beasley

UNLABELLED A gradual decline in estrogen levels after the age of 40 may contribute to a higher rate of depression in women over 45 years of age. Estrogen replacement therapy (ERT) has been shown to produce cognitive and mood-enhancing effects in women and may facilitate antidepressant activity. METHODS We examined the efficacy rates in women on ERT > or = 45 years (n = 40) compared to women > or = 45 years not on ERT (n = 132) and to women < 45 years (n = 396) and to men (n = 262) with major depression during fluoxetine 20 mg daily up to 8 weeks. Remitters with a HAM-D17 score < or = 7 from week 9 to 12 were then treated up to 1-year in a placebo-controlled, relapse-prevention trial. RESULTS Efficacy rates were similar in women > or = 45 years on ERT when compared to women > or = 45 years taking fluoxetine alone, and when compared to women < 45 years and men taking fluoxetine. A Kaplan-Meier survival analysis in fluoxetine responders treated up to 26 weeks showed a somewhat greater relapse rate in women > or = 45 years taking ERT compared to other treatment groups (P < 0.06). LIMITATIONS This study was retrospective nature and ERT was given in an uncontrolled fashion: 63% of women received estrogen alone while 37% also took intermittent progesterone. Other variables include the absence of hormonal documentation of menopausal status, no direct assessment of ERT compliance and the use of fixed-dose fluoxetine 20 mg daily. CONCLUSION In contrast to prior reports suggesting that ERT may facilitate antidepressant activity, we observed similar efficacy in depressed women > or = 45 years taking fluoxetine plus ERT compared to those taking fluoxetine alone.


Biological Psychiatry | 1998

A Double-Blind, Controlled Comparison of the Novel Antipsychotic Olanzapine versus Haloperidol or Placebo on Anxious and Depressive Symptoms Accompanying Schizophrenia

Gary D. Tollefson; T.M. Sanger; Charles M. Beasley; Pierre V. Tran

BACKGROUND Depressive symptoms are a common feature of schizophrenia and may represent a core part of the illness. Where present, it has been associated with greater overall morbidity and mortality. Monotherapy with conventional dopamine antagonists may either worsen or bestow a limited therapeutic benefit. Accordingly the use of adjunctive thymoleptics has been explored. In contrast, olanzapine (OLZ), an atypical antipsychotic agent, offers a distinctive and pleotropic pharmacology suggestive of a broader efficacy profile than conventional neuroleptic agents. METHODS In a 6-week placebo- and haloperidol (HAL)-controlled trial with 335 randomized subjects with chronic schizophrenia in an acute exacerbation, three fixed dose ranges of OLZ (5, 10, or 15 +/- 2.5 mg) were evaluated versus HAL (10-20 mg) or placebo. RESULTS Baseline to endpoint change in the Brief Psychiatric Rating Scale including the anxiety-depression cluster (items 1, 2, 5, 9) was analyzed. Two dose ranges of OLZ (10 +/- 2.5, 15 +/- 2.5) were superior to placebo (p < 05) in improving mood status, whereas HAL was not. CONCLUSION Contributions from a more selective mesolimbic dopaminergic profile, D1 or D4 activity, the release of dopamine/norepinephrine in the prefrontal cortex, and/or serotonin 5-HT2A,C antagonism may explain the differential benefit seen with OLZ in the treatment of comorbid anxious and depressive symptoms in schizophrenia.


Neuropsychopharmacology | 1998

Olanzapine versus placebo and haloperidol: quality of life and efficacy results of the North American double-blind trial.

S.H. Hamilton; Dennis A. Revicki; Laura A. Genduso; Charles M. Beasley

This double-blind study evaluated the impact of treatment with olanzapine compared with haloperidol, and placebo on improvements in symptomatology and quality of life in patients with a DSM-III-R diagnosis of schizophrenia. A total of 335 patients was randomized to five treatment groups; olanzapine 5 ± 2.5 mg/day, olanzapine 10 ± 2.5 mg/day, olanzapine 15 ± 2.5 mg/day, haloperidol 15 ± 5 mg/day, and placebo. Patients responding to treatment during the 6-week acute phase were eligible to enter a 46-week extension. Efficacy measures included the brief psychiatric rating scale total, scale for assessment of negative symptoms summary, and clinical global impressions severity scores. Quality of life was evaluated using the quality of life scale. Data analyzed after 24 weeks of therapy showed that olanzapine was significantly superior to placebo in reducing clinical severity and significantly superior to haloperidol in reducing negative symptoms in patients responding to acute treatment. Furthermore, improvement in quality of life was observed in olanzapine-treated responders.
